CNBC's Jim Cramer has voiced growing unease about the potential impact of a SpaceX initial public offering, suggesting it could siphon speculative capital away from other stocks and destabilize the broader market. The veteran commentator expressed concern over the current level of IPO speculation, particularly around high-profile names like Elon Musk's space venture.

In a recent segment on CNBC's "Mad Money," Jim Cramer warned that the much-anticipated SpaceX IPO, which has been the subject of intense market chatter in recent months, may prove "destructive" for the rest of the stock market. Cramer noted that the speculative frenzy surrounding such a high-profile offering could draw a disproportionate amount of investor attention and capital away from existing equities, potentially creating volatility in other sectors. Cramer did not provide specific timing for the SpaceX IPO, but he highlighted the growing risk of what he described as "IPO mania" in the current market environment. He emphasized that while SpaceX is a remarkable company with strong fundamentals, the sheer scale of public interest could lead to a concentration of speculative trading that might distort valuations across the board. The commentator has previously expressed caution about the broader IPO market, but his latest remarks reflect a heightened level of concern, particularly as meme stocks and SPACs have seen renewed activity in recent weeks. The exact terms and valuation of a potential SpaceX offering remain unconfirmed, but market participants have been closely watching for any regulatory filings. Cramer's comments come amid a backdrop of mixed market sentiment, with the major indices experiencing moderate gains this month, though some analysts have pointed to signs of frothiness in certain growth and technology names. Jim Cramer's comments reflect a cautious perspective on the evolving IPO landscape, particularly for companies with outsized brand recognition and speculative appeal. While no specific data points were provided regarding SpaceX's financials or IPO terms, his warning suggests that market participants should be mindful of the potential for capital flows to become concentrated in a single event. From a market structure standpoint, a mega-IPO like SpaceX could temporarily distort liquidity and valuation benchmarks, as traders may rotate out of existing positions to participate. Such dynamics have been observed in previous high-profile listings, where the announcement alone led to short-term volatility in related sectors, including aerospace and defense. However, without concrete details on the offering's size or timing, the actual impact remains uncertain. Investors may want to monitor broader market sentiment and positioning in the weeks ahead, particularly if IPO-related speculation intensifies.
